Mission Fest celebrates the importance of our shared missions as United Methodists. The events will bring congregations face-to-face with those serving missions on our behalf and help individuals discover opportunities to serve in mission locally and globally.
We are called as disciples to live out our call in misison to our communities, state, nation and world through gifts of time, service and financial resources.
The challenge will end with a day of celebration in Garden City Nov. 10 and another in Newton on Nov. 11. Guest speaker will be Dr. Thomas Kemper, general secretary for the General Board of Global Ministries.

Youth and adults across the annual conference are challenged to raise funds for six mission projects by collecting 100,000 pennies and 100,000 quarters by mid-November. The goal is to raise $26,000 to be split between six causes:
Mary Lou Reece, wife of Bishop Scott Jones, is team captain for the adults. Bishop Scott Jones is team captain for the youth. Who will lead their team to victory?
